Comprehending Car Keys: Types and Technologies
Modern automobiles normally use a variety of key types, each with its own replacement process and cost implications. Below are the primary types of car keys:
Traditional Car Keys: These are easy metal keys without electronic elements. Replacement costs are reasonably low.
Transponder Keys: Equipped with a chip that interacts with the car key replacement cost estimate's ignition, these keys supply an included layer of security. Replacement requires programming, making the cost greater.
Smart Keys/Fob Keys: These key fobs run remotely, enabling keyless entry and ignition. Due to their sophisticated technology, they are among the most pricey to change.
Switchblade Keys: These keys fold into the fob when not in use, combining functions of traditional and smart keys. Replacement costs are moderate.

Various elements can impact the general expenses associated with replacing car keys. Here are some key elements to think about:
Make and Model of the Vehicle: Luxury or modern lorries may have more intricate systems, leading to greater prices for parts and labor.
Key Type: As detailed above, not all key types have the very same replacement costs.
Programming Requirements: Keys like transponder and smart keys often require specialized equipment for programming, which can add to the overall expenditure.
Place: Prices can differ by geographical areas, with urban centers typically charging more due to higher functional expenses.
Company: Dealerships normally charge more for key replacement than locksmiths or mobile services.

Traditional Key Replacement: For a basic car key, the overall cost might be around ₤ 15 to ₤ 25, including cutting.
Transponder Key Replacement: This might total between ₤ 90 to ₤ 350 due to the fact that of the key's chip and programming needs.
Smart Key Replacement: Expect costs upwards of ₤ 200 to ₤ 600 due to innovative innovation and programming.
Do it yourself vs. Professional Help
Some car owners think about DIY techniques for key replacement. While changing a conventional key is simple, transponder and smart keys require sophisticated programming that most owners can not manage at home. Therefore, it's a good idea to speak with a professional locksmith or dealer when handling sophisticated keys.
FAQsQ1: How long does it require to change a car key?
A1: The time needed depends on the type of key. Standard keys can be cut and ready in minutes, while transponder and smart keys can take anywhere from 20 minutes to an hour, especially if programming is included.
Q2: Can I drive my car without a key?
A2: Typically, no. Modern lorries are designed to avoid operation without the appropriate key, especially those with transponder systems. Nevertheless, calling a locksmith might help in some keyless entry situations.
Q3: Are there any service warranties for changed keys?
A3: Some dealerships offer warranties on key replacements, especially for high-end automobiles or more complicated key types. Constantly ask about terms before continuing with a replacement.
Q4: Is it possible to configure a new key myself?
A4: Some lorries permit self-programming through particular series. However, this process differs by make and model, and it's often easier and much safer to entrust this task to an expert.
